Zymeworks faces significant uncertainty because its long-term growth depends on identifying or acquiring assets that can successfully progress through preclinical and clinical development. Even when candidates advance to trials, the historically high failure rates in biopharmaceutical development mean that promising early data may not translate into later-stage success.
This risk is amplified by factors such as safety and efficacy concerns, clinical execution challenges, evolving standards of medical care and shifting regulatory expectations across jurisdictions. As a result, assets that appear attractive at the investment stage may ultimately fail to meet FDA or ex-U.S. regulatory requirements, undermining future revenue potential and strategic partnerships.
